After a disappointing series loss against the United Arab Emirates, the Bangladesh national cricket team remains under scrutiny. There will be no rest for the squad, as they are set to depart for Pakistan from Dubai this Sunday to take on a strong side led by Salman Ali Agha in a three-match T20I series.

Meanwhile, two players from the UAE series — Soumya Sarkar and Nahid Rana — have returned to Dhaka, as they are not included in the squad for the upcoming tour. Nahid withdrew due to personal reasons, while Soumya has been ruled out with a back injury.

In light of Nahid Rana’s withdrawal, Mehidy Hasan Miraz has been added to the T20 squad. Conveniently, Miraz is already in Pakistan, currently playing in the Pakistan Super League (PSL). Fellow Bangladeshi spinner Rishad Hossain is also in Pakistan for the same reason.

Additionally, left-arm pacer Mustafizur Rahman, who recently completed his stint with Delhi Capitals in the Indian Premier League (IPL), will fly directly from India to Pakistan to join the squad.

All three matches of the T20I series will be held at the Gaddafi Stadium in Lahore between May 28 and June 1. The series will kick off with the first T20I on May 28, followed by the second and third matches on May 30 and June 1, respectively. Each game will begin at 9:00 PM Bangladesh Standard Time.
